nomadic
英 [nəʊˈmædɪk]
美 [noʊˈmædɪk]
adj. 游牧的;游牧生活的; 流浪的; 漂泊的
Collins.1 / BNC.12637 / COCA.15019
柯林斯词典
- ADJ 游牧的;游牧部落的
Nomadicpeople travel from place to place rather than living in one place all the time.- ...the great nomadic tribes of the Western Sahara.
西撒哈拉伟大的游牧部落
- ...the great nomadic tribes of the Western Sahara.
- ADJ-GRADED 流浪的
If someone has anomadicway of life, they travel from place to place and do not have a settled home.- The daughter of a railway engineer, she at first had a somewhat nomadic childhood.
作为一个铁路工程师的女儿,她最初的童年生活有些漂泊不定。
- The daughter of a railway engineer, she at first had a somewhat nomadic childhood.
